Responsible gaming and safety in quick-win-games-ng

Responsible gaming is a must in quick-win-games-ng. Licensed operators enforce KYC (Know Your Customer) checks, require age verification (18+), and set daily or weekly limits. You should decide a safe budget before you start and use breaks if you feel pressured or stressed. If you need a pause, enable temporary bans or self-exclusion options provided by the casino platform. In Nigeria, many players use 24/7 chat support and email to set these controls, keeping the focus on fun and not on debt.

Time limits help a lot. Quick-play sessions are designed to be short, but it is easy to slip into longer bouts. Set a timer in your phone or use the casino’s built-in reminder. If you encounter any payout delays or suspicious activity, contact support immediately and document the transaction IDs. This habit protects your ₦ and your reputation as a careful player.
